Ticket: Staging env misconfigured for Siftgate bloom filter

The bloom layer in front of the Pellet KV store is rejecting all lookups in staging because the env file was copied from the dev template without credentials. False-positive tuning values are fine; only the auth line is missing. To unblock the weekly demo, the Pellet admission secret must be set on the following line.

env line for yaguf-fajop: LEDGER_TOKEN13=fb08984397349

During the winter holiday period, the Larchgate Annex operates reduced hours: 08:00–16:00 on weekdays, closed weekends. Reception at the main Ketterwell Building remains staffed, but contractors should plan deliveries and site visits within Annex hours. After 16:00, the side entrance on Pemberly Walk is the only access point, and it requires the contractor door code provided below.

staff pass of kawip-hawef = bdg-QLP-2

### Audit item 7 — DeployBot status replies

Quick one, but don't skip it: confirm the Shiply chat bot reports the actual pipeline state, not the cached one from the last poll. We had a scare last quarter where it said "green" mid-rollback. Check the staleness banner appears after 90 seconds without a heartbeat, and that failed deploys ping the right channel. Questions or oddities should go straight to the bot's owner, named below.

named custodian: Oliath Ralax